Output ecc6af6d61da64fae8d90f092c2032e578e819b85dfd71233d557bc8be4188b5:0

value
36616
script pubkey
OP_0 OP_PUSHBYTES_20 09debf374782602556a6af65ed3aec532a121d5d
address
bc1qp80t7d68sfsz244x4aj76whv2v4py82aj5ym7y
transaction
ecc6af6d61da64fae8d90f092c2032e578e819b85dfd71233d557bc8be4188b5
confirmations
45912
spent
true